Ownership changes coming for two Butler businesses

Spring is coming... and so are some changes at two popular Butler businesses. It was recently announced that Murray's Auto Repair is relocating to the current Don's Tire location on March 1st. The Murray's are looking forward to the increased work space which will afford a shorter wait for customers, plus tires and wheel alignment will be added to the list of offerings. Don Malan will continue to operate his tow/recovery business.


It was also made public that popular uptown restaurant Southside Cafe will also be under new ownership soon. Owners Randy and Diane Weiss, after a long and successful run, will be handing over the keys to new owners Rodger Koehn and Brandon Conger on March 1st. Koehn and Conger plan a few changes for the establishment, including the offering of alcoholic beverages.

Mid America Live will be providing more information in the near future as it becomes available.

More stolen property recovered in Garden City storage unit burglaries


Officers of the Garden City Police Department recover more stolen property from multiple storage unit burglaries.

At about 10:00 this morning officers of the Garden City Police Department responded to a residence in the 200 block Main Street and recovered property that had been reported as stolen earlier this month from a storage unit also located on Main Street


The occupants of the residence were cooperative and the suspect in the burglary is being held in the Cass County Jail on multiple charges.

Obituary - Jim Kochsmeier

Jim Kochsmeier
Memorial/Visitation for Jim Kochsmeier will be Friday, February 12, 2015 from 5-6 p.m. at Schowengerdt Funeral Chapel (660-679-6555) in Butler, Missouri. There will be a prayer followed by military honors concluding at 6 p.m. at Schowengerdt Chapel. Inurnment at later date in Pleasant Ridge Cemetery, Harrisonville, Missouri. Contributions to Heartland Hospice.

Jim Kochsmeier, age 81 of Butler, Missouri died Monday, February 8, 2016 in Butler. He was born July 14, 1934 to John Conrad and Ethel Ona Williams Kochsmeier in Harrisonville, Missouri.

Jim is survived by three stepsons, Robert Todd and Larry Todd, both of Butler, Missouri and Travis Todd of St. Joseph, Missouri; two stepdaughters, Norma Jean Berry and husband Jim of Butler, Missouri and Patsy Yates of Adrian, Missouri; two sisters, Nadine Cunnings of Harrisonville, Missouri and Betty Hicks and husband Bob of Warsaw, Missouri; and 6 grandchildren, 10 great-grandchildren and 6 great great-grandchildren. He was preceded in death by his parents; wife Ethel in 2015; infant stillborn Ethel Rosalie; and stepgrandson Robbie Todd.

Obituary - Robert Larry Boehm


Memorial services for Larry Boehm will be 11 a.m. Saturday, March 12, 2016 at Lynn Valley Community Church. Arrangements under the direction of the Schowengerdt Funeral Chapel (660-679-6555) in Butler, Missouri. Online condolences, www.schowengerdtchapel.com.

Robert Larry Boehm, age 77 of Butler, Missouri died Friday, January 8, 2016 at his home in Butler. He was born September 28, 1938 to Howard Isaac and Mamie Florene Howell in Kansas City, Kansas.

Larry is survived by his wife, Glenys June Boehm of Butler, Missouri; two sons, DeWayne Boehm of Amsterdam, Missouri and Rodney Boehm of Amoret, Missouri; one daughter, Kammie Smalley and husband Ronnie of Butler, Missouri; one sister, Marjie Elanie DuBois and husband Terry of Paola, Kansas; and five grandchildren and six great-grandchildren. He was preceded in death by his parents; and one son, Curtis Dale Boehm in 1980.
